Eastern New Mexico football head coach Kelley Lee announced a 2019 fundraising campaign geared towards raising funds for additional games and travel for the Greyhound football team throughout the next few years of competition.

The Hounds already have a trip up to Monmouth, Oregon planned for the end of the 2019 season to take on Western Oregon and with the Lone Star Conference and Great Northwest Athletic Conference reaching a scheduling alliance covering the 2020 and 2021 seasons, long road trips will become a staple in the Greyhounds scheduling. The Hounds are currently scheduled to host Azusa Pacific in 2020 and will then host Central Washington and travel to Azusa Pacific during the 2021 season.

“In order to achieve our goal of becoming the first Eastern New Mexico football team to reach the NCAA Division II playoffs it is imperative that we play 11 NCAA Division II football games every year,” coach Lee said, “Our young men have been working extremely hard and we are asking that you consider supporting them by making a donation to help cover the increased cost of plane tickets for the travel associated with such long trips.”

The new agreement between the LSC and the GNAC will guarantee the Hounds at least three in-region contests over the 2020 and 2021 seasons, but Eastern will still be in search of games against non-conference foes to complete an 11 game schedule each year. The costs associated with the travel to these non-conference games continues to rise and the need for extra funds has never been greater for ENMU football.

The Greyhounds finished last season 5-6 after putting together a record of 8-2 the previous season to put themselves squarely in contention for a berth in the NCAA Division II playoffs. With a long list of impact players returning and a schedule consisting of quality, in-region opponents for the 2019 year, the Hounds will be looking to make a run at the program’s first ever Division II playoff berth and will need additional financial help to continue that type of scheduling in the next coming years.
